Although people denied it, there was interest in Caglar Soyuncu from Barcelona back in May. Then, it was know that Barcelona had been following the Turkish central defender since 2016, but the reported interest was quickly rejected by all parties.
Now, 'NTV Spor' have once again said Barca want the Leicester central defender. According to the Turkish media outlet, the Catalans would pay around 40 million euros for the footballer, who would sign for five seasons.
The defender joined the Premier League for slightly more than 20 million euros and in his two campaigns at Leicester, he has put in solid performances. This was especially the case last season when he got into the eleven.
Despite the fact Leicester worsened after the coronavirus stoppage and had to settle for a Europa League spot, Soyuncu's performances were good.
The Turkish international played 42 games for Brendan Rodgers' men this season and he scored a goal and gave an assist. He is a central defender who can play on the left side despite being right footed.
